The vulnerability of the sec_attest_info() function (drivers/accel/habanalabs/common/habanalabs_ioctl.c) in the Linux operating system allows a hacker to gain unauthorized access to protected information.

The vulnerability of the secattestinfo function drivers/accel/habanalabs/common/habanalabsioctl.c in the Linux kernel is related to insufficient protection of service data when processing the Pad0 field. Ransomware Gang Files SEC Complaint

A ransomware gang, annoyed at not being paid, filed an SEC complaint against its victim for not disclosing its security breach within the required four days. Public companies must now disclose breaches within 4 days

Public organisations in the US impacted by a cyberattack will now have to disclose it within four days…with some caveats attached.
